Tiananmen student leader secretly detained in China

13 May 2009

The family of exiled Zhou Yongjun, a prominent student leader in the 1989 Tiananmen Square movement, say he has been detained trying to enter mainland China and held without charge for more than six months in a secret detention centre. Read more here
